How an engagement works

A clear decision.
At every step.

  1. 01

    Free Operational Fit Scan

    A free 20-minute conversation about one recurring workflow. Check fit and decide whether a paid diagnostic is a sensible next step. No system access or obligation to continue.

  2. 02

    Paid Workflow Diagnostic

    Investigate the workflow, evidence and likely constraint. Receive options and a recommendation, including preparation, existing tools or no build. Agree the diagnostic fee and scope before it begins.

  3. 03

    Custom Implementation Proposal

    Where a change is justified, review the scope, custom price, responsibilities, dependencies, acceptance checks and ongoing costs. Decide separately whether to approve it.

  4. 04

    Approved Build

    Implement only the approved scope. Validate quality, human approval rules, exception handling and the release or manual fallback before use.

  5. 05

    Agreed Ongoing Operation

    Agree monitoring, support, usage and third-party costs, measurement and exit arrangements. Further operation or expansion requires agreement.

Every Croox implementation is custom. We first diagnose the workflow, data, systems and operating requirements. Where a build is justified, you receive a scoped proposal with pricing, responsibilities and acceptance criteria before deciding whether to proceed. The diagnostic is a separate paid engagement, with its fee agreed before it begins. You are not committed to implementation.

Before we start

A few clear answers.

When will I know the price?

The diagnostic fee is agreed before it begins. Implementation is custom-priced after diagnosis, with scope, acceptance checks and ongoing costs in the proposal. You decide separately whether to proceed. How pricing works ↗

What if we do not need a build?

The diagnostic can recommend clearer ownership, better use of existing tools, preparation or no build. You are buying a decision, with no automatic implementation commitment. Explore the diagnostic ↗

Are these client results?

No. Company Research is a recorded execution. The Northstar diagnostic sample is fictional. Neither establishes client savings or business improvement. Inspect the evidence ↗
